Public dog park
Smith River Paw Park
Smith River Paw Park in Axton, Virginia is a fully-fenced dog park located at 1000 Irisburg Rd. Dog owners are required to keep their dogs on a leash at all times and to carry a leash with them. Only two dogs per handler are allowed in the park, and dogs must wear collars and ID tags. The park includes amenities such as drinking water for dogs, open fields, and access to the river. Owners are responsible for any damage or injury caused by their dogs, and aggressive dogs are not allowed. The park is open from 7:00 a.m. until dusk. Visit their website at https://www.smithriversportscomplex.com/event-information/paw-park or contact them at (276) 638-7297 or [email protected] for more information.

Public dog park
5(1)
Salem Rotary Dog Park
Salem Rotary Dog Park is located at 1301 Indiana St in Salem, Virginia. The park is fully fenced and offers amenities such as agility equipment, chairs, dog drinking water, and a lit field. Rules include leashing dogs upon entering and exiting, no digging, no other animals allowed, and no food or toys. Children under 16 must be accompanied by an adult, and dogs less than four months old or exhibiting aggression are not allowed. Female dogs in season are also prohibited. The park is open Monday to Friday from 6 AM to 10 PM. For more information, visit their website at https://salemva.gov/Facilities/Facility/Details/Salem-Rotary-Dog-Park-24 or call (540) 375-3057.
